What is Will County property tax search?

Will County property tax search is a process that allows individuals to look up information about property taxes on a specific property in Will County, Illinois. This search can provide details such as the property’s assessed value, tax rate, amount of taxes owed, and more.

FAQs about Will County property tax search:

1. How can I conduct a Will County property tax search?

To conduct a Will County property tax search, you can visit the official website of the Will County Treasurer’s Office and use their online search tool.

2. What information do I need to perform a Will County property tax search?

You will typically need the property’s address, parcel number, or property identification number (PIN) to perform a Will County property tax search.

3. Is there a fee associated with conducting a Will County property tax search?

No, conducting a Will County property tax search is typically free of charge and can be done online through the county’s official website.

7. Can I dispute the assessed value of my property through the Will County property tax search tool?

Yes, property owners can typically file a property tax assessment appeal if they believe their property has been over-assessed.

8. Are there any exemptions or deductions available that I can apply for through the Will County property tax search?

Yes, there are various exemptions and deductions available to property owners, such as the homestead exemption, senior citizen exemption, and more, which can help reduce property tax obligations.

9. How can I find out if my property qualifies for any exemptions through the Will County property tax search?

You can usually find information about available exemptions and their eligibility criteria on the Will County Treasurer’s Office website or by contacting their office directly.
